Walgreens likely to deliver another sickly earnings report for 4Q

Walgreens Boots Alliance Inc (NASDAQ:WBA) reports its fourth-quarter and full-year 2023 results ahead of the opening bell on October 12, 2023, and analysts are bracing for another sharp decline in earnings.

The drugstore operator has had to contend with a weak consumer environment, as well as increased competition from online pharmacies.

Its results come a day after a two-day staged walkout by employees to protest what they describe as unsafe working conditions that compromise customer health.

They also follow the August 31 departure of CEO Rosalind Brewer, which followed the resignation of the company’s global chief financial offer James Kehoe a few weeks earlier.

Interim CEO Ginger Graham and interim CFO Manmohan Mahajan will deliver this week’s results and field questions from investors in a pre-market conference call.

While the company is expected to post a 6.5% year-over-year improvement in net sales to $34.56 for the quarter, earnings per share are likely to be down 15% at $0.68, according to Zacks Investment Research.

The company also reported a decline in 3Q earnings as consumers curtailed spending, with the result that it cut its full-year guidance to a range of $4 to $4.05 per share, down from its previous range of $4.45 to $4.65 per share.

Ahead of its results, the company’s shares were 2% up at $22.23 in Monday afternoon trading. They’ve fallen 40% year to date.
